Learn more Shopify offers 80 themes in total, nine of which are free. The rest will cost you a one-time fee ranging from $140 – $180.We love how many options Shopify gives its users, but choosing the best Shopify theme for your site – one that you like, with all the tools you want – can feel overwhelming! Ask an Expert: Daniel Driesen, Senior Brand DesignerGo easy on the color scheme“In my personal opinion, it’s important to use colors – but it’s also very easy to overdo it. I always recommend staying within two to three colors maximum, to keep things visually attractive.“It’s also good to work with opacities or lighter colors. These create separations, which break up sections and make content easier to digest. Ask an Expert: Kirill Zeynalov, DesignerDon’t forget about fonts“Choosing the right typeface is an important element of web design.
